WACO, Texas (KXXV) — A new type of vending machine has arrived in Spice Village in Waco, offering shoppers the chance to purchase charitable donations instead of snacks or sodas.
The Light the World Giving Machines, installed by The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ints, allow customers to buy items for those in need with the simple push of a button. The machines support six Central Texas nonprofits, plus the worldwide charity CARE, and offer everything from comfort kits for hospitalized children to goats for families in developing countries.
"You can donate a counseling session for a victim of violent crime," said Aleigh Ascherl from the Advocacy Center for Crime Victims & Children.
